在移动互联网快速发展的背景下,Android设备产生的数据量呈指数级增长。传统的批处理方式已无法满足实时性需求,因此构建高效的流式数据处理架构成为关键。
流式数据处理的核心在于持续接收、处理和分析数据流。与批量处理不同,流式处理强调低延迟和高吞吐量,适用于实时监控、用户行为分析等场景。

2026AI设计稿,仅供参考
Android端的流式数据架构通常包含数据采集、传输、处理和存储四个主要模块。数据采集通过传感器或网络接口获取原始数据,传输则依赖于高效的通信协议如WebSocket或MQTT。
在数据处理阶段,采用轻量级的流处理框架如Apache Flink或Kafka Streams,可以实现对数据的实时计算和过滤,减少不必要的数据冗余。
为了提升性能,架构设计需考虑内存管理和任务调度优化。例如,使用异步处理机制和事件驱动模型,可有效降低系统延迟并提高资源利用率。
•数据存储部分需要结合时序数据库或NoSQL系统,以支持高并发写入和快速查询,确保数据的可用性和可靠性。